久しぶりに TOMCAT を build したので メモ(本当にメモです)間違っていると思ってください。。 時間を見てまとめます。。 今回は /usr/opt/MOD 以下にtomcat5.5 の環境を作成する。 始めに setenv_java を作成しておく。。 #!/bin/sh # file : setenv_java # Source function library. # . /etc/rc.d/init.d/functions # # ANT_HOME=/usr/opt/MOD/lib/ANT ANT_HOME=/usr/opt/ant JAVA_HOME=/usr/opt/java TOMCAT_HOME=/usr/opt/tomcat PATH=$JAVA_HOME/bin:$ANT_HOME/bin:$PATH # CLASSPATH=$JAVA_HOME/*.jar # export JAVA_HOME PATH CLASSPATH TOMCAT_HOME export ANT_HOME # # DONOT USE ( DEBUG ) export WORK_LIB_DIR=/usr/opt/MOD/lib export CLASSPATH=$WORK_LIB_DIR:$CLASSPATH # # export CLASSPATH=$WORK_LIB_DIR/junit-4.7.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/JAXWS.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/xercesImpl.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/jakarta-oro-2.0.8.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/jakarta-regexp-1.5.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/resolver.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/xmlsec.jar:$CLASSPATH export CLASSPATH=$WORK_LIB_DIR/jakarta-log4j-1.2.6.jar:$CLASSPATH # # exit 0 # http://www.jajakarta.org/ant/ant-1.6.1/docs/ja/manual/install.html#installing # # apache-ant-1.7.1 # ant-current-bin.zip apache-tomcat-5.5.28-src.tar.gz jdk-6u16-linux-x64.bin # ant-current-src.zip apache-tomcat-5.5.28.tar.gz work # #     Java API for XML-Based Web Services (JAX-WS) # !ANT の作成 ここでは何をインストールしたかわからない。。 最後に動いたのは -rw-r--r-- 1 root root 6662580 Sep 24 15:59 apache-tomcat-5.5.28.tar.gz -rw-r--r-- 1 root root 5043206 Sep 24 15:59 apache-tomcat-5.5.28-src.tar.gz -rw-r--r-- 1 root root 9604954 Sep 24 15:59 ant-current-src.zip -rw-r--r-- 1 root root 11657986 Sep 24 15:59 ant-current-bin.zip -rw-r--r-- 1 root root 232354 Sep 24 16:14 junit-4.7.jar -rw-r--r-- 1 root root 170142 Sep 24 17:18 jakarta-regexp-1.5.tar.gz -rw-r--r-- 1 root root 345304 Sep 24 17:19 jakarta-oro-2.0.8.tar.gz -rw-r--r-- 1 root root 262701 Sep 24 17:24 xml-commons-resolver-1.2.tar.gz -rw-r--r-- 1 root root 4478367 Sep 24 17:30 xml-security-bin-1_0_5D2.zip -rw-r--r-- 1 root root 1711507 Sep 24 19:23 Xerces-J-src.2.9.1.tar.gz -rw-r--r-- 1 root root 4379682 Sep 24 19:25 Xerces-J-tools.2.9.1.tar.gz -rw-r--r-- 1 root root 44186990 Sep 24 21:21 jdk-1_5_0_21-linux-amd64.bin -rw-r--r-- 1 root root 170952349 Sep 24 18:32 java_ee_sdk-5_07-jdk-6u16-linux-ml.bin -rw-r--r-- 1 root root 81871260 Sep 24 15:59 jdk-6u16-linux-x64.bin を入れてからであった java が java5 と java6 があるのは後述。。